Organic vanilla whole milk yogurt is the more energy-dense option here, packing 26 more calories per 100g than Whole Milk. If you are looking for sustained energy or fueling a workout, this higher caloric density might be an advantage.
However, watch out for the sugar content. Organic vanilla whole milk yogurt contains significantly more sugar (10g) compared to the milder Whole Milk (4.58g). If you are monitoring your insulin levels or trying to cut down on sweets, Whole Milk is undeniably the healthier pick.
